Analysis

Latin America & Caribbean recorded 323.75 billion BoP, current US$ for service exports in 2025. That is the highest value across all 49 years on record.

That represents a change of up 5.9% on the previous year and up 75.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, service exports in Latin America & Caribbean peaked at 323.75 billion BoP, current US$ in 2025 and was at its lowest, 12.55 billion BoP, current US$, in 1977.

Latin America & Caribbean ranks 22nd of 43 groups on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Service exports in Latin America & Caribbean, year by year

Annual values for Service exports (BoP, current US$) in Latin America & Caribbean, 1977 to 2025.
Year BoP, current US$ Change
1977 12.55 billion BoP, current US$
1978 14.15 billion BoP, current US$ +12.8%
1979 17.87 billion BoP, current US$ +26.3%
1980 20.23 billion BoP, current US$ +13.2%
1981 21.22 billion BoP, current US$ +4.9%
1982 19.75 billion BoP, current US$ -6.9%
1983 18.89 billion BoP, current US$ -4.3%
1984 20.30 billion BoP, current US$ +7.5%
1985 21.56 billion BoP, current US$ +6.2%
1986 22.39 billion BoP, current US$ +3.9%
1987 24.83 billion BoP, current US$ +10.9%
1988 27.92 billion BoP, current US$ +12.5%
1989 32.49 billion BoP, current US$ +16.4%
1990 36.78 billion BoP, current US$ +13.2%
1991 38.72 billion BoP, current US$ +5.3%
1992 43.45 billion BoP, current US$ +12.2%
1993 47.37 billion BoP, current US$ +9.0%
1994 51.53 billion BoP, current US$ +8.8%
1995 53.37 billion BoP, current US$ +3.6%
1996 57.02 billion BoP, current US$ +6.8%
1997 63.87 billion BoP, current US$ +12.0%
1998 58.62 billion BoP, current US$ -8.2%
1999 60.42 billion BoP, current US$ +3.1%
2000 66.56 billion BoP, current US$ +10.2%
2001 65.48 billion BoP, current US$ -1.6%
2002 67.46 billion BoP, current US$ +3.0%
2003 73.01 billion BoP, current US$ +8.2%
2004 81.57 billion BoP, current US$ +11.7%
2005 94.37 billion BoP, current US$ +15.7%
2006 105.17 billion BoP, current US$ +11.4%
2007 122.43 billion BoP, current US$ +16.4%
2008 139.96 billion BoP, current US$ +14.3%
2009 127.39 billion BoP, current US$ -9.0%
2010 142.10 billion BoP, current US$ +11.6%
2011 161.58 billion BoP, current US$ +13.7%
2012 172.24 billion BoP, current US$ +6.6%
2013 179.05 billion BoP, current US$ +4.0%
2014 187.64 billion BoP, current US$ +4.8%
2015 184.26 billion BoP, current US$ -1.8%
2016 191.60 billion BoP, current US$ +4.0%
2017 204.56 billion BoP, current US$ +6.8%
2018 213.55 billion BoP, current US$ +4.4%
2019 219.63 billion BoP, current US$ +2.8%
2020 141.19 billion BoP, current US$ -35.7%
2021 179.59 billion BoP, current US$ +27.2%
2022 247.85 billion BoP, current US$ +38.0%
2023 280.32 billion BoP, current US$ +13.1%
2024 305.71 billion BoP, current US$ +9.1%
2025 323.75 billion BoP, current US$ +5.9%

Exports of services are services provided by residents to non-residents.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
